Subject: Quickstore 4.2 — bloom filter now fronts the KV layer

Plugin authors: starting with this release, Quickstore places a bloom filter ahead of the key-value store. Negative lookups return faster; false positives fall through safely. No API changes are required on your side. Verify your plugin against the staging build referenced below.

session token of fahif-tadup = htk3_9c7

During the Fennimore outage, the loyalty-points ledger drifted because the reconciler's batch window overlapped with the nightly accrual job, and retries compounded duplicate credits. Going forward, the reconciler must acquire the ledger lease before each batch, and the batch size must stay small enough that a lease renewal always precedes expiry. Maintainers changing any of these values should rerun the double-credit regression suite and document the result. The agreed constants are recorded below.

tuning table, kajog-kawef:
PRIORITIES = {
    "kelox": 870,
    "kasix": 89,
    "eliax": 988,
}

v3.8.0 — Key rotation and dark-mode release (Gullwharf Admin Dashboard). This release ships the long-requested dark-mode support, including theme persistence per operator account and adjusted contrast on all chart components. As part of standard quarterly hygiene, the artifact signing key was rotated; all prior keys are revoked effective this release. Release manager action: re-verify the staged bundle against the new key before promoting to the Fennick production cluster. The new signing key for this cycle appears below.

rollout seal: bky4_x7Gc

Ticket: Studio booking — training videos. Hey facilities, the Larkspin enablement team needs Studio 2B on the fourth floor next Tuesday to record onboarding clips. Can you make sure the soundproof door is unlocked by 9am and the lighting rig is working? Their producer will swing by your desk first. Give her the studio door code below.

door code, fajef-tahog: bdg-Q-71